Workhorse is a software developer focused on order and inventory management for manufacturers and traders. Its platform is designed to model complex supply-to-demand workflows with multiple fulfillment steps and product elements, enabling improved stock visibility and margin management to drive profitability through greater operational efficiency.
Based in Redhill, England, the company serves businesses seeking to streamline inventory control and order processing, helping them adapt to intricate supply chains. The offering situates Workhorse within the software and operations management segment, aiming to help its customers scale more profitably by providing configurable workflow modeling and visibility across their operations.
